Kenyan vs Immigrants from Guyana Disability Age 18 to 34 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 168,169,697 people shows a moderate positive correlation between the proportion of Kenyans and percentage of population with a disability between the ages 18 and 35 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.487 and weighted average of 6.8%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 183,492,322 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Guyana and percentage of population with a disability between the ages 18 and 35 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.239 and weighted average of 5.5%, a difference of 23.5%.
